C# reflection determine if struct
WebCreating a C# Console Application: Now, create a console application with the name GarbageCollectionDemo in the D:\Projects\ directory using C# Language as shown in the below image. Now, copy and paste the following code into the Program class. Please note here we are not using a destructor. using System; WebNov 24, 2024 · Support ref struct and "fast invoke" by adding new reflection APIs. The new APIs will be faster than the current object[] boxing approach by leveraging the existing System.TypedReference.. …
C# reflection determine if struct
Did you know?
WebOct 27, 2024 · If your data type can be a value type that holds the data within its own memory allocation (e.g., int, double) and it needs to be immutable, then you should use structs. Structs are value types. WebJan 21, 2024 · at System.Reflection.RuntimeMethodInfo.ThrowNoInvokeException() at System.Reflection.RuntimeMethodInfo.InvokeArgumentsCheck(Object obj, BindingFlags …
WebJul 17, 2024 · One obvious way to enforce Equals and GetHashCode for structs is to use FxCop rule CA1815. But there is an issue with this approach: it is a bit too strict. A performance critical application may … WebApr 22, 2024 · Taking a deep dive into reflection. Reflection acts on three important reflection properties that every Golang object has: Type, Kind, and Value. ‘Kind’ can be one of struct, int, string, slice, map, or one of the other Golang primitives. The reflect package provides the following functions to get these properties:
WebExample to understand While loop in C# Language: In the below example, the variable x is initialized with value 1 and then it has been tested for the condition. If the condition returns true then the statements inside the body of the while loop are executed else control comes out of the loop. The value of x is incremented using the ++ operator ... WebApr 21, 2014 · Depending on the structure of the wall, not every wall reflection is a specular reflection. ... Air pressure, temperature and humidity determine the speed of sound as well as the air absorption and thus influence the sound propagation inside the room. 2.3.3. Spatial Data Structures. ... C++, Python, RhinoScript (Visual Basic, C#)
WebIn C#, reflection is a process to get metadata of a type at runtime. The System.Reflection namespace contains required classes for reflection such as: Type MemberInfo ConstructorInfo MethodInfo FieldInfo PropertyInfo TypeInfo EventInfo Module Assembly AssemblyName Pointer etc. The System.Reflection.Emit namespace contains classes …
crystal visions stevie nicksWebJun 21, 2024 · Any struct that you define already has a default implementation of value equality that it inherits from the System.ValueType override of the Object.Equals(Object) … dynamic preaching magazine subscriptionsWebTwo methods were inherited from the parent class A plus one method which we defined in class B. So, we can say Class A contains two methods and class B contains 3 methods. This is the simple process of Inheritance in C#. Simply put a colon (:) between the Parent and Child class. dynamic power systems beaumont txWebMar 17, 2008 · I've got a struct public struct Price { public decimal amount; public override string ToString() { return amount.ToString(); } } I also have a class that contains several … dynamic power query sourceWebC# Reflection; C# 在c中,哪个从JsonConvert.DeserializeObject或自定义模型绑定执行fast# C# Entity Framework Linq; C# 在C中的datagridview中自动完成# C#; C# C语言中使 … dynamic precision abWebFor Loop in C#: For loop is one of the most commonly used loops in the C# language. If we know the number of times, we want to execute some set of statements or instructions, then we should use for loop. For loop is known as a Counter loop. Whenever counting is involved for repetition, then we need to use for loop. dynamic power redistribution moduleWebC# 使用可空结构是否可以提高性能?,c#,performance,struct,garbage-collection,C#,Performance,Struct,Garbage Collection,我的想法如下: 既然结构可以提 … crystal visions tarot book